What Is Fathom?

Fathom, founded by Andrew Lockhart and Christopher Bockman, focuses on structuring clinical data to enhance healthcare efficiency globally. The company specializes in AI-powered medical coding automation, leveraging deep learning and natural language processing to reduce costs and increase accuracy.

With locations in New York City, San Francisco, and Toronto, Fathom serves a wide range of healthcare providers. The company employs between 51-200 people, reflecting its growing influence in the medical coding industry.

Fathom's technology aims to provide rapid turnaround times for coding patient encounters, making it a valuable asset for healthcare systems worldwide.

How Much Funding Has Fathom Raised?

  1. Series B Funding Round
    • Amount Raised: $46 million
    • Date: November 2022
    • Lead Investors: Alkeon Capital and Lightspeed Venture Partners
    • Motivation Behind the Round: To expand the number of specialties and health systems supported by Fathom and to scale its engineering team.

Fathom has raised a total of $46 million in funding. The current valuation is not disclosed.

Key Investors

  • Lightspeed Venture Partners
    • Details: Lightspeed is a venture capital firm that invests in the enterprise, consumer, and health sectors. It has a global presence with offices in Silicon Valley, Israel, India, and China.
    • Investment Focus Areas: Enterprise, consumer, health
    • Notable Investments: Snap, GrubHub, Nest
  • Alkeon Capital
    • Details: Alkeon Capital is a global investment firm that focuses on technology and growth sectors. The firm is known for its long-term investment approach and deep industry expertise.
    • Investment Focus Areas: Technology, growth sectors
    • Notable Investments: Spotify, Pinterest, Stripe
  • Google Ventures (GV)
    • Details: Google Ventures is the venture capital arm of Alphabet Inc., investing in various sectors including technology and healthcare. GV provides funding and support to startups at different stages of development.
    • Investment Focus Areas: Technology, healthcare, innovation
    • Notable Investments: Uber, Slack, Medium
  • 8VC
    • Details: 8VC is a venture capital firm that invests in technology and healthcare startups. The firm aims to build and support transformative companies that create long-term value.
    • Investment Focus Areas: Technology, healthcare
    • Notable Investments: Palantir, Wish, Guardant Health
  • Cedars-Sinai
    • Details: Cedars-Sinai is a non-profit hospital and healthcare organization based in Los Angeles. It is renowned for its medical research and innovation in healthcare services.
    • Investment Focus Areas: Healthcare, medical innovation
    • Notable Investments: Various healthcare startups and medical technologies
